发明名称 |
Video transmission system with color prediction and method of operation thereof |
摘要 |
A video transmission system and the method of operation thereof includes: a base layer encoder unit encodes a first video frame for generating a first encoded video frame and a color reference frame including dynamically partitioning the color space of the first video frame; an enhancement layer encoding unit for generating a subsequent encoded video frame by differentially encoding a resampled color frame reference and a subsequent video frame; a video stream transport accessed by a bit stream multiplex unit for multiplexing the first encoded video frame and the subsequent encoded video frame; a reference capture unit to generate a decoded video stream by capturing the resampled color frame reference, for decoding the video stream transport, by applying the subsequent encoded video frame to the resampled color frame reference; and a display, coupled to the reference capture unit and the decoded video stream from the video stream transport, for displaying the decoded video stream. |

主权项 |
1. A method of operation of a video transmission system comprising:
encoding a first video frame for generating a first encoded video frame and a color reference frame including dynamically partitioning a color space of the first video frame; generating a subsequent encoded video frame by differentially encoding a resampled color frame reference, from the color reference frame, and a subsequent video frame; accessing a video stream transport by multiplexing the first encoded video frame and the subsequent encoded video frame; generating a decoded video stream by capturing the resampled color frame reference, for decoding the video stream transport, by applying the subsequent encoded video frame to the resampled color frame reference; presenting on a display the decoded video stream from the video stream transport; and analyzing a partition of the color space of the first video frame for determining a Cb partition based on an average value of a Chroma Cb range of the first video frame, wherein the color space can include two or more of the partitions. |
